Overview
Los Angeles senior assistance programs provide vital support to the city's growing senior population, addressing needs such as food insecurity, healthcare, transportation, and social isolation. With a wide range of services, from meal delivery to caregiver support, these programs rely on donations, volunteers, and partnerships with local organizations like the [[los-angeles-department-of-aging|Los Angeles Department of Aging]] and the [[area-agency-on-aging|Area Agency on Aging]]. Key players like the [[la-county-commission-for-older-adults|LA County Commission for Older Adults]] and the [[city-of-los-angeles-senior-services-division|City of Los Angeles's Senior Services Division]] work together to ensure that seniors have access to the resources they need to thrive. With a focus on dignity, independence, and quality of life, Los Angeles senior assistance programs make a tangible difference in the lives of thousands of seniors every day.
